Understanding the Freightliner M2 Air Dash Valve

The air dash valve, also known as the brake control valve, is the central controller of the air brake system. It receives input from the brake pedal and modulates the air pressure supplied to the brake chambers, which in turn actuate the brakes. The Freightliner M2 air dash valve is a dual-function valve that combines the following functions:

  1. Service Brake Valve: Controls the air pressure applied to the brake chambers during normal braking operation.
  2. Parking Brake Valve: Engages the parking brakes when the dash valve is pulled out.

Function and Operation

The air dash valve operates on the principle of pneumatic actuation. When the brake pedal is depressed, it moves a pushrod that actuates the valve spool. The spool's movement controls the flow of compressed air to the brake chambers, resulting in the application of braking force. The valve also incorporates an exhaust port that releases air from the brake chambers when the brake pedal is released.

Troubleshooting Common Problems

The following are common problems that may occur with the Freightliner M2 air dash valve:

  1. Brake Drag: Brakes may continue to drag even after the brake pedal is released. This can be caused by a faulty dash valve spool or a clogged exhaust port.
  2. Low Brake Pressure: Insufficient braking force may indicate a leak in the air line or a malfunctioning dash valve.
  3. Parking Brake Engagement Failure: The parking brakes may not engage properly if the dash valve is not fully pulled out or if the parking brake valve is faulty.
  4. Air Leaks: Leaks in the air dash valve can cause a drop in air pressure and reduced braking performance.
